Introduction to MaxQuant
Trainers: Carlo de Nart, Peli Kyriakidou
Overview: This presentation will give a general overview of the computational workflow that is implemented in MaxQuant as well as detailed descriptions of the algorithmic implementations of the core building blocks.
Learning outcomes
By the end of this session you will be able to:
- Describe MaxQuant purpose
- Use MaxQuant to:
– Analyse raw data from high resolution MS
– Use Andromeda search engine for peptide identification
– Peptide/protein quantification
– Data visualisation in the Viewer

Practical overview: During this hands-on training the participants will learn how to use MaxQuant to process their mass spectrometric raw data. The trainer demonstrates step by step how to set up and run a MaxQuant analysis and explain the viewer component which allows a visual inspection of the analysed data.
